Description:

The Faculty of Arts of the University of Groningen is seeking an Assistant Professor in Psycholinguistics (60% teaching, 40% research). The candidate should be able to teach in the bachelor’s programme Linguistics, the master’s programme Neurolinguistics and the research master’s programmes in Linguistics.

The research of the candidate will form part of the Center for Language and Cognition Groningen (CLCG) research institute, more in particular the Neurolinguistics and Language Development research group. The candidate will also be affiliated with the Research School of Behavioural and Cognitive Neurosciences (BCN) and the Neuro Imaging Center (NIC) in Groningen.

Specific tasks:

- Teaching course units in the field of psycholinguistics, research methodology and statistics within various bachelor’s degree programmes and master’s degree programmes at the Faculty of Arts, including the bachelor’s programme Linguistics, the master’s programme Neurolinguistics and the research master’s programmes in Linguistics
- Supervising bachelor’s and (research) master’s theses in the field of psycholinguistics
- Conducting research at a recognized level in the field of psycholinguistics
- External grant acquisition
- Performing administrative and organizational duties

Qualifications

In addition to a number of basic requirements set by the University of Groningen, such as excellent social and communicative skills, presentation skills, coaching skills and a results oriented attitude, we are looking for a candidate who has a PhD in the field of Psycholinguistics or a related field and,

In the area of teaching:

- Has teaching experience in the field of psycholinguistics at university level and proven didactic abilities
- Has gained the University Teaching Qualification or is prepared to do so within a year
is able to make contributions to the development of course units, partly by actively linking teaching to research.

In the area of research:

- Has an excellent research track record with at least two refereed international publications every year
- Has extensive experience with eye tracking and EEG/ERP methods for psycholinguistic research and preferably has knowledge of advanced statistical modelling techniques
is able to set up his or her own research line and publish within it, dovetailing with the profile of the research institute
- Has an outstanding international network
- Has attracted significant funding
- Is experienced in PhD supervision or is prepared to play an active role in this.

In the area of management and organization:

- Has a good command of Dutch or is willing to learn the language within two years
- Is able to make a constructive contribution to interdisciplinary collaboration and a friendly atmosphere within the faculty and university
- Has demonstrable management capacities and organization skills.
